Yaskawa arc welding robot AR2010 product features:
1. Fast welding speed, improving welding production efficiency,
2. Adopting a hollow arm structure, it is possible to choose between welding internal or external wiring of cables, allowing for suitable equipment for customers' work and equipment,
3. Adopting a design that reduces interference between the arm and peripheral devices. Contribute to the space saving of equipment.

Characteristics of YRC1000 TIG Robot Controller for Argon Arc Welding:
1. Small, high-speed, high-precision, and easy to operate
2. Dimensions: 598 (width) x 427 (depth) x 490 (height) mm, 125L
3. Load: Small purpose: 70kg, medium/large purpose: 85kg (can accommodate external 3-axis)

Introduction to TIG Robot Welding Machine for Argon Arc Welding
Bigao WSME315/500: Variable frequency AC/DC pulse argon arc welding machine, with pulse welding, wire feeding welding, water cooling, suitable for carbon steel; Stainless steel, aluminum alloy
Ethernet digital communication is used for welding materials and connecting with robots.

TX-DZFZ 300 model introduction:
1. This model is an integrated compact dual station reversible welding workstation
2. Dual station application, welding on one side and loading and unloading on the other side, improving productivity
3. Integrated model, no installation required, floor standing and functional
4. The digital control system is simple and easy to learn
5. Small footprint, improving production efficiency
6. Suitable for gas shielded welding, argon arc welding, laser welding
7. Suitable for parts that require welding at multiple locations
